Introduction About OLWORM PLUS ORAL SUSPENSION
OLWORM PLUS ORAL SUSPENSION contains a combination of Albendazole and Ivermectin, which belongs to a group of medicines called Anthelmintics. It is used to manage infections caused by roundworm, infections caused by tapeworm, infections caused by pinworm, parasitic infections of the skin, parasitic infections of hair, inflammatory diseases, and other conditions.
OLWORM PLUS ORAL SUSPENSION is used to manage parasite infections, which can destroy disease-causing worms and effectively inhibit the spread of illness. Albendazole manages the worm from absorbing glucose, resulting in energy loss. Ivermectin works by paralyzing the worms and causing them to die.
Before taking this OLWORM PLUS ORAL SUSPENSION, inform your doctor if you have decreased blood count, severe liver, kidney, or heart problems.
Pregnant and breastfeeding women consult your doctor for advice before taking this medicine. The common side effects are n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, stomach pain, and skin rashes. How OLWORM PLUS ORAL SUSPENSION Works
OLWORM PLUS ORAL SUSPENSION works against the parasite by managing it from consuming glucose and therefore depleting its energy stores and also causes the insect to become paralyzed, causing it to die.

Side Effects Of OLWORM PLUS ORAL SUSPENSION
Common
- facial or limb swelling
- dizziness
- confusion
- sudden drop in blood pressure
- nausea
- vomiting
- diarrhea
- stomach pain
- skin rashes

Warning & Precautions
Pregnancy
Consult your doctorThere are no adequate and well-controlled studies in pregnant women; hence, consult your doctor for advice before taking OLWORM PLUS ORAL SUSPENSION.
Breastfeeding
Use with CautionOLWORM PLUS ORAL SUSPENSION may pass into breast milk; it should be used with caution during breastfeeding. Consult your doctor before taking OLWORM PLUS ORAL SUSPENSION.
Liver
Use with CautionOLWORM PLUS ORAL SUSPENSION should be used with caution if you have liver disease; your dose will be adjusted if needed. Consult your doctor for advice.
Allergy
ContraindicatedDo not take OLWORM PLUS ORAL SUSPENSION if you are allergic (hypersensitive) to Albendazole or Ivermectin.
Use In Pediatrics
Consult your doctorThis OLWORM PLUS ORAL SUSPENSION will be prescribed by the doctor according to the child’s age and body weight. Consult your doctor before taking OLWORM PLUS ORAL SUSPENSION.
Others
Tell your physician before taking this OLWORM PLUS ORAL SUSPENSION if you:
- have or had loa loa infection
- are suffering from brain problems
- have a bleeding disorder
- have asthma
